1 On 9 July the Affinity Quartet took home first prize and AUD30,000 (£15,800) at the Melbourne International Chamber Music Competition. The Madrid-based quartet comprises violinists Josephine Chung and Nicholas Waters, violist Ruby Shirres and cellist Mee Na Lojewski. They also won the AUD30,000 Robert Salzer Foundation String Quartet prize and the AUD8,000 Audience Prize. In the Piano Trio category, Trio Orelon (violinist Judith Stapf, cellist Arnau Rovira i Bascompte and pianist Marco Sanna) was awarded the AUD22,500 first prize, as well as the AUD3,000 Trio Commission Prize.
